Computer Aided Design (CAD) Technology Information


This program is designed to prepare students to enter the high-demand world of Computer Aided Design (CAD) Technology. Students use their creativity as they bring ideas to life. As CAD technicians they work hand-in-hand with scientists, engineers, architects and designers. CAD technicians prepare detailed CAD drawings based on rough sketches, specifications and calculations. They are an integral part of any industrial project.

Student Learning Outcomes

Student will be able to:

  • Understand and apply proper techniques for analyzing and producing manual and computer generated drawings.
  • Understand and apply proper techniques for analyzing and producing three-dimensional computer generated models.
  • Differentiate the application of common engineering materials.
  • Understand and apply proper techniques for analyzing and producing drawings of industrial systems.
